Service indicator
turn key on position 2 at the same time holding the reset button on the ipak. when it starts blinking let it go then it will say time. hold for couple seconds till it says reset then press it again it will say date hold it again till it says reset then its all done
Put the key in the ignition.
That is position "0"
Turn the key forward one click, that is position "1"
Turn the key one more click, that is position "2", also known as the "run" position, that is the position the key is in after you start the engine and let go of the key.
The next position is the "start" position.
